Vietnamese Dong (VND)
The Vietnamese dong (VND) is the official currency of Vietnam, a country located in Southeast Asia. The dong has been Vietnam's currency since 1978 and is issued by the State Bank of Vietnam, the country's central bank. Vietnam has one of the fastest-growing economies in the world, driven by a strong export sector, manufacturing industry, and a growing services sector. Despite this economic growth, the dong has historically maintained a low exchange rate compared to many other currencies, reflecting the country's economic policies and inflation challenges.
Kenyan Shilling (KES)
The Kenyan shilling (KES) is the official currency of Kenya, a country in East Africa. The shilling was introduced in 1966 and is issued by the Central Bank of Kenya. Kenya's economy is diversified with agriculture, tourism, and the services sector being key contributors. The country also has a growing technology sector, often referred to as "Silicon Savannah." The Kenyan shilling has been relatively stable over the years but is influenced by both domestic and global economic factors.
